What do I need to make cheesy Alfredo tater tot casserole?

To make alfredo tater tot casserole you will need bacon, alfredo sauce, green onion, parsley, garlic, dry mustard, frozen tater tots, chicken breast (cooked), and parmesan cheese!

That might seem like a lot but most of these ingredients can be kept on hand pretty easily. You can even make the chicken and bacon ahead of time and refrigerate or freeze them for use when you are ready.

Printable Cheesy Tater Tot Casserole Recipe:

Yield: 8 Serving

Cheesy Tater Tot Casserole

Featured image showing portion of cheesy tater tot casserole ready to serve.

Making a cheesy tater tot casserole with alfredo sauce, chicken, and bacon is simple and fun. This delicious casserole is perfect for dinner!

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 50 minutes
Total Time 1 hour 5 minutes

Ingredients

  • 6 slices bacon, chopped
  • 2 jars alfredo sauce - 13 oz
  • ½ cup green onion, chopped
  • ¼ cup parsley
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 teaspoon dry mustard
  • 32 oz frozen tater tots
  • 3 cups chicken breast, cooked and chopped
  • ½ cup parmesan cheese, shredded

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350 and prepare a 13x9 baking dish with nonstick spray
  2. Cook bacon, chop, and set aside
  3. In a large bowl mix alfredo sauce, green onion, parsley, garlic, and dry mustard until well combined
  4. Stir in bacon, chicken, and tater tots
  5. Spoon into baking dish and top with cheese
  6. Bake 50 minutes to 1 hour
  7. Garnish with parsley, serve, and enjoy!
